What this work involves

Most collision work that arrives here started as a low-speed incident. Clipping a gate post, catching a curb with a rear overhang, backing a fifth wheel into a post at a campsite. The repair cost is rarely proportional to the speed of the impact, because RV body panels are structural in a way car panels are not. A sidewall on a laminated coach is a load-bearing sandwich, so a hole in it is a structural repair, not a dent.

How long does RV collision repair take?

Simple panel and paint work runs one to two weeks. Structural jobs run four to twelve weeks, and the parts wait is usually the longest single stage, not the labor. Cap and sidewall components on older coaches are frequently made to order.

Can I choose my own repair shop, or does my carrier decide?

In California you choose the shop. A carrier can recommend a direct repair program shop, but it cannot require you to use one. We work with every major carrier regardless of program status.
